TRANSLANGUAGING IN BILINGUAL CLASSROOM: A CASE STUDY OF MATHEMATICS BILINGUAL PROGRAM AT UNIVERSITAS NEGERI MAKASSAR

This research aims to investigate translanguaging in a bilingual classroom. Hence, this research tries to see the practice of translanguaging in bilingual classrooms. This research focused on how translanguaging facilitates the teaching and learning of the Mathematic Bilingual program at Universitas Negeri Makassar. This research applied a qualitative method, and the instruments were classroom observation and interview. The result of observation and interview was transcribed and analyzed based on the research focus. The findings of this research showed that the lecturers expressed a positive perception toward translanguaging which was reflected through ten positive comments about the use of translanguaging in the bilingual classroom. Translanguaging facilitated the teaching and learning of the Mathematic bilingual program was the first to make their English teaching in the classroom effective and the second was to make the students understand the teaching and learning material well. The way lecturers conducted translanguaging was based on the situation of the students. If the students did not understand what the lecturers explained in English, they used translanguaging in the classroom to make the teaching and learning process understandable.
THE IMPLEMENTATION OF THE HERRINGBONE TECHNIQUE IN READING NARRATIVE TEXT

This study aims to determine the increase in students' reading comprehension of narrative texts after applying the herringbone technique. This study a quantitative method. To achieve the research objectives, this study used an instrument in the form of a reading comprehension test. The population of this study was all class XI students at SMA Negeri 7 Pinrang, totaling 244 students from 7 different classes, in the odd semester of the 2023–2024 academic year. The interview sample was 34 students in class XI F of SMA Negeri 7 Pinrang, in the odd semester of the 2023–2024 academic year. As a result of the data analysis carried out, researchers can conclude that the application of the herringbone technique in reading can improve students' reading comprehension in narrative texts at SMA Negeri 7 Pinrang.

STUDENTS’ PERCEPTIONS TOWARD GAMIFICATION APPLIED IN ENGLISH LANGUAGE EDUCATION FBS UNM

This qualitative study explores students' perceptions of gamification, a strategy incorporating game-like elements into education, to understand its impact on contemporary learning. The objective is to assess whether students view gamification as a positive or negative tool for learning in the classroom. Five students with prior experience using gamification participated in the study, selected through purposive sampling. The primary method of data collection was in-depth interviews. Findings indicate that students generally perceive gamification positively. Benefits noted include increased enjoyment and interactivity in learning, enhanced motivation and competitive spirit, and the development of critical thinking, problem-solving, and collaboration skills. However, the study also identifies several challenges associated with gamification, namely technical and accessibility issues, potential reduction in personal interaction, an overemphasis on competition, and distractions from educational objectives.

TEACHERS’ PERCEPTIONS ON THE USE OF ENGLISH AS A MEDIUM OF INSTRUCTION AT EX-RSBI PUBLIC JUNIOR SECONDARY SCHOOLS IN MAKSSAR

The objectives of this research were to find out (1) the difference between teaching and learning using English at the RSBI program and Merdeka curriculum (2) the teachers’ perceptions on which program more enhances students’ English development and academic content (3) the teachers’ suggestions on the use of EMI (teaching Science and Math using English). This research applied descriptive qualitative research design. Interviews and documentation were used as the instruments to collect data. The participants of this research were five teachers from SMP Negeri 6 Makassar and SMP Negeri 12 Makassar. The participants were all Mathematics and Science teachers and had experienced the RSBI program. The results of the research showed: (1) students' competitive attitudes have decreased and the intensity of using EMI has decreased since the RSBI program was abolished, (2) there has been a decline in students' academic achievement and schools’ performance compared to when the RSBI program was still ongoing, (3) teachers' commitment, developing an ELT policy and re-programming bilingual classes are suggested to infuse the use of EMI into classroom pedagogy.

THE INFLUENCE OF ONLINE LEARNING ON STUDENT’S LEARNING STYLES AT SMP NEGERI 5 POLEWALI

This research aims to analyze the influence of online learning on students' learning styles at SMP Negeri 5 Polewali. The COVID-19 pandemic has brought significant changes in the world of education, especially through the sudden shift from face-to-face learning to online learning. This study aims to analyze the effect of online learning on students' learning styles at SMP Negeri 5 Polewali. This research used qualitative methods with data collection techniques through interviews, observation, and documentation. The research sample involved students of class IX A. The results showed that there are various obstacles in the implementation of online learning, such as limited technology and internet access. However, online learning also affects students' learning styles, which are divided into three main types: visual, auditory, and kinesthetic. Students with visual learning styles find it easier to understand material through pictures and videos, while auditory students are helped more by verbal explanations. Kinesthetic students have difficulty in online learning due to limited physical activity. This research concludes that learning styles affect the effectiveness of online learning, and teachers need to adapt teaching strategies to suit the needs of each learning style to improve student learning outcomes. This research provides implications for the development of more effective and inclusive online learning strategies in the future.

USING TASK-BASED LEARNING METHOD TO ENHANCE STUDENTS’ LITERAL READING COMPREHENSION

The objective of this study was to ascertain whether or not the task-based learning method can enhance students' inferential reading comprehension. A pre-experimental design with pre-test and post-test was employed in this study, which was conducted with all students in the 11th grade as the population. The sample consisted of 36 students from class 11.2 at UPT SMAN 5 Pinrang. The data were collected via an inferential reading comprehension test and subsequently analyzed using a paired sample t-test. The findings indicated a statistically significant enhancement in students' inferential reading comprehension, as evidenced by a probability value of less than 0.001, which was below the 0.05 significance threshold. The t-value (14.244) exceeded the t-table value (2.03), thereby confirming the acceptance of the alternative hypothesis (Ha). Additionally, the N-Gain value was classified as high (>0.70), providing further evidence of the effectiveness of this method. These findings demonstrate that the task-based learning method is an effective method to significantly enhance students' inferential reading comprehension. Consequently, this method can be a viable alternative teaching strategy for enhancing reading comprehension within similar educational contexts.
